I got them to pay as soon as I warned them they appeared to be living up to their notary rotary.com reputation. Jay Zukerberg is the one who cuts the checks (and actually runs the company). But, I'm not clear as to why they operate as Safir Signings and Genuine Title.

Specifically, I did a signing on 6/27, but didn't submit the invoice to them until 7/5. Their invoice says all checks are cut on the 30th of the month. I asked Shannan Smoot when I could expect payment, and she said by 8/5. By 8/15 still had not received payment. Told them I was a very ugly bill collector, and the check came out right away.

So, when Shannan says they do pay, I agree, they do. I can only imagine the reason for the dummy signing company is that it gives them a minimum of 30 days to pay, rather than at close of the deal like tc's are required to do.
